Output 8582f66ddb97c58a18b2d9d2957037230ce83a737d858f0e2fceb8ec621fb451:1

value
2283837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f843e65a99aceaa4e5ef55c5e98ba74cb825e2a5 OP_EQUALVERIFY OP_CHECKSIG
address
1PdhvLVnNcBSiE7e9tP1cymGD7ntibSWrX
transaction
8582f66ddb97c58a18b2d9d2957037230ce83a737d858f0e2fceb8ec621fb451
spent
true